The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Assembly approved a supplementary budget comprising additional expenditure of Rs121 billion for the current financial year in the absence of the opposition.
Opposition walks out after cut motions barred
The opposition did not take part in the voting after it was not allowed to move cut motions and staged a walk-out from the House. According to the assembly session was chaired by Speaker Babar Saleem Swati. Provincial Minister for Law and Finance Aftab Alam, along with other ministers, presented the departments' demands for grants before the House.
PML-N’s Sobia Shahid protests at speaker's dais
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) member Sobia Shahid first protested in front of the speaker's dais after being denied permission to move cut motions and later walked out with other opposition members.
House approves 59 grant demands without Opposition
The House approved 59 demands for grants in the absence of the opposition. Provincial Minister for Law and Finance Aftab Alam also presented the authenticated schedule for the current financial year before the Assembly.
An amount of Rs50.49 billion was spent on current expenditure, while Rs71.73 billion was allocated to the development budget.
